wie wärs mit einem padding (oder maring) für die entsprechenden elemente innen drinnen, wenn der text innen drinnen einen abstand haben soll?
ich kann dir übrigens nicht folgen, welchen container du menist
ok, anscheinend ist es doch so weit dass ich den Quelltext posten muss:
HTML:
<div class="container">
<div class="divnavi">
NAVI
</div><br />
Hier soll dann der Inhalt rein, der den Innenabstand haben soll.
<div class="push"></div>
</div>
<div class="divfooter">
FOOTER
</div>
CSS:
html, body {
height:100%;
margin:0;
}
.container {
background-color:#CCFF00;
min-height: 100%;
height: auto !important;
height: 100%;
overflow: auto;
width: 700px;
margin: 0 0 -20px 0;
border-right-width: 1px;
border-right-style: solid;
border-right-color: #000000;
text-align: justify;
padding-left: 5px; <- Der Innenabstand wird eingehalten vom Text, aber natürlich hält dann auch der Navi-div den Innenabstand zum Container ein.
padding-right: 5px;
}
.divnavi {
height: 150px;
background-color:#FF0000;
}
.divcontent {
background-color:#CCFFFF;
overflow: scroll;
}
.divfooter, #push {
height: 20px;
background-color:#66FF66;
width: 700px;
}